On Positive Education Day we encourage schools across Australia and beyond to celebrate by “colouring their threads for PosEd”, wearing colourful clothes to make wellbeing visible in schools.
We are grateful to the schools that collected donations on the day, which will be applied towards funding scholarships for teachers from disadvantaged schools in each state and territory to attend the PESA 2022 National Wellbeing in Conference.

The PESA 2022 National Wellbeing in Education Conference will offer the opportunity for the education community to reconnect with one another and to the fundamental pillars of wellbeing in schools: Students, Staff and Culture. The program will address the challenges facing educators with regard to implementation of wellbeing science by providing the current developments in theory and research, as well as helping educators to connect evidence, research and theory to the creation of practical classroom and school-wide strategies to enhance student wellbeing and academic attainment. This conference is also designed to be a wellbeing intervention for staff.
